Best 83644 Idaho Public Preschools (2024)

For the 2024 school year, there are 2 public preschools serving 1,210 students in 83644, ID.
The top ranked public preschools in 83644, ID are Middleton Mill Creek Elementary School and Middleton Heights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public preschools in zipcode 83644 have an average math proficiency score of 48% (versus the Idaho public pre school average of 43%), and reading proficiency score of 59% (versus the 52% statewide average). Pre schools in 83644, ID have an average ranking of 8/10, which is in the top 30% of Idaho public pre schools.
Minority enrollment is 13%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Idaho public preschool average of 26% (majority Hispanic).
